The optimal grade for early spring application — withstands temperatures down to −18°C without crystallisation. Three nitrogen forms provide immediate (nitrate), medium-term (ammonium) and prolonged (amide) nutrition. Preferred for regions where frost is possible during the application period.
Maximum nitrogen concentration among UAN grades — 32%. Optimal for warm regions and summer top-dressing at consistently positive temperatures. Smaller volume per nitrogen unit reduces transport costs and speeds up pumping operations. Most economical in terms of cost per kg of nitrogen.
Intermediate grade with an optimal balance between nitrogen concentration and crystallisation temperature. Suitable for temperate climates in spring and summer. Convenient for mixed storage conditions where UAN-28 frost resistance is not needed but occasional frost protection is required.
Liquid complex NP fertilizer with high phosphorus content — 34% P₂O₅ in fully water-soluble form. Applied in-row at sowing for starter nutrition and in fertigation systems. Phosphorus in liquid NP is absorbed significantly faster than from granular forms.
UAN Storage Requirements: tanks made of stainless steel (AISI 304/316), fibreglass or polyethylene. Carbon steel and zinc corrode aggressively in contact with UAN. Minimum storage temperature for UAN-28: above −18°C; for UAN-32: above −2°C. If you do not have your own storage tanks, ask our manager about tank rental options.

| Parameter | UAN-28 | UAN-30 | UAN-32 | Liquid NP 10-34-0 |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Nitrogen (N), % | 28 | 30 | 32 | 10 |
| P₂O₅, % | — | — | — | 34 |
| Crystallisation temp. | −18°C | −9°C | −2°C | −18°C |
| Density, g/cm³ | 1.28 | 1.30 | 1.32 | 1.38 |
| Early spring application | yes | yes | no | yes |
| Foliar top-dressing | yes (1:3–1:5) | yes (1:3–1:5) | yes (1:4–1:5) | no |
| In-row application | no | no | no | yes |
| Fertigation | yes | yes | yes | yes |

UAN is applied in three ways — each suited to specific crops, growth stages and conditions.
Application by soil injectors with incorporation at 5–10 cm depth or delivery into a furrow. Eliminates ammonia volatilisation. Used for basal spring application and under autumn tillage. Rate: 100–200 l/ha depending on grade concentration and target N dose.
No dilution required · Minimum nitrogen losses
UAN is diluted with water 1:3 to 1:5 and applied by sprayer to growing crops. Compatible with most pesticides — saving application passes. Do not apply when temperature exceeds +25°C or in windy conditions. Solution rate: 100–200 l/ha.
Dilution 1:3–1:5 · Compatible with PPP
UAN is delivered into the drip irrigation system in diluted form. Solution pH of 7.0–8.5 is compatible with most irrigation systems. Pre-application compatibility check with water source is recommended (hardness, pH). Effective for vegetable crops and orchards.
Dilution as calculated · Check water pH first
UAN is effective for all cereal and oilseed crops — especially when combining top-dressing with pesticide applications.
Foliar UAN top-dressing at early tillering (BBCH 21–25) 30–40 kg N/ha — primary yield increase of 3–6 dt/ha. Combined with fungicide application.
Soil application in spring 80–100 kg N/ha before vegetation starts. Foliar top-dressing at rosette stage — additional 20–30 kg N/ha combined with insecticide.
Soil injection before sowing 80–120 kg N/ha with incorporation. Foliar top-dressing at 3–5 leaf stage 30–40 kg N/ha combined with herbicide.
UAN applied under pre-sowing cultivation 60–80 kg N/ha. Foliar top-dressing not recommended — risk of leaf burn due to trichomes. Soil injector or band application.
UAN by soil injector before sowing or at early row closure 80–100 kg N/ha. Tank-mix with herbicide possible during foliar top-dressing.
Barley, spring wheat. UAN-28 for early spring start 60–80 kg N/ha. Foliar top-dressing at tillering combined with insecticide or fungicide.
UAN via fertigation through drip system — 2–4 kg N/ha per application. Liquid NP 10-34-0 for starter nutrition at early growth stage.
The key agronomic advantage of UAN — compatibility with most herbicides, fungicides and insecticides in one tank. Saves 1–2 application passes per season.

The main difference is nitrogen concentration (28% vs 32%) and crystallisation temperature (−18°C vs −2°C). UAN-28 is preferred for early spring application when overnight frost is still possible — the solution will not freeze in the tanker and pipelines. UAN-32 is applied at consistently positive temperatures (from May to August) and is more cost-effective per unit of nitrogen due to its higher concentration. For temperate climates, UAN-28 is optimal in spring and UAN-32 for summer top-dressing. For warmer regions — UAN-32 throughout the season.
UAN is compatible with most herbicides, fungicides and insecticides — this is its key agronomic advantage. Combining top-dressing with crop protection saves 1–2 machinery passes per season, reducing fuel costs and soil compaction. However, before mixing always perform a jar test (trial mixing in a jar): certain products based on alkaline surfactants or containing calcium or magnesium may precipitate. UAN should not be mixed with mancozeb-based products or certain strobilurins without prior testing.
UAN is corrosive to carbon steel, zinc, copper and their alloys. Approved materials: stainless steel AISI 304 or 316L, fibreglass, high-density polyethylene (HDPE), polypropylene. Seals and gaskets — EPDM or PTFE (Teflon). Rubber and PVC are not suitable. The tank must be fitted with a closed fill/discharge system and a vent valve. In terms of cost per unit of nitrogen, UAN and ammonium nitrate are comparable. The main UAN savings are operational: liquid fertilizer is applied faster (sprayer capacity exceeds spreader output), dosed more precisely and combined more easily with pesticides. On large areas (from 500 ha), savings on machinery, fuel and labour when using UAN are significant per season. Furthermore, UAN is non-explosive unlike ammonium nitrate, which removes storage and transport restrictions. For smaller farms without liquid fertilizer storage infrastructure, ammonium nitrate may be more practical.

UAN (urea-ammonium nitrate solution) is a liquid nitrogen fertilizer — an aqueous solution of ammonium nitrate and urea. The key property of UAN is its simultaneous content of three nitrogen forms: nitrate (NO₃⁻), ammonium (NH₄⁺) and amide CO(NH₂)₂. This provides rapid initial action from nitrate nitrogen, prolonged nutrition from ammonium and slow release from amide nitrogen through nitrification in soil.

UAN is non-explosive (unlike ammonium nitrate) — no storage volume restrictions, no specialised warehouses required. The liquid form ensures precise dosing and uniform nitrogen distribution across the field without dust or caking. Liquid fertilizer application throughput using sprayers is significantly higher than solid spreader capacity.
Soil application of UAN by injectors with soil incorporation is the most efficient method: ammonia nitrogen losses are minimal. Foliar top-dressings with UAN diluted 1:3–1:5 with water are carried out on growing crops in the morning hours at temperatures below +20°C. Hot weather and wind make foliar application inadvisable.
